QSN750型直读光谱仪测定抗震钢筋中碳、硅、锰、磷、硫含量的不确定度评定

摘    要:依据JJF1059—1999相关技术规范,对QsN750型直读光谱仪测定抗震钢筋中碳、硅、锰、磷、硫含量的不确定度进行了评定和表述,分析了影响测量不确定度的各个因素,计算出各个分量并将其合成。

Evaluation of uncertainty for determination of C,Si,Mn,P and S in aseismic ribbed bar by QSN 750 direct reading spectrometer

Abstract:Based on the standard JJF1059-1999, the sources of the uncertainty by QSN 750 direct reading spectrometer for determination of C,Si,Mn,P and S in aseismic fibbed bar are analyzed, and the uncertainty of C,Si,Mn,P and S is evaluated and expressed. The value of uncertainty components in measurement is calculated and combined.
